What “Best” Really Means for Lead Generation
The best website visitor tracking software is the one that helps you do three things consistently.
- See which pages and behaviors predict leads
- Remove friction that stops visitors from converting
- Follow up with the right visitors based on real intent
Most teams get the fastest results by combining two or three tools, not by trying to find one platform that does everything.
The 3 Tool Types That Drive Leads
To turn anonymous traffic into leads, you typically need these layers.
- Measurement analytics
Traffic sources, conversions, funnels, and attribution - Behavior analytics
Heatmaps and session replay to find why visitors do not convert - Lead generation tracking
Company level visibility, intent alerts, and activation into your marketing workflows
Best Tools by Category
Below are the tool categories that matter most for lead generation, plus common options in each category.
1. Measurement Analytics
This layer answers: what is working, what is not, and where are we losing leads.
Google Analytics 4
Best for: conversion tracking, funnel analysis, and event based measurement.
Use it when:
- You want a source of truth for conversions and funnel drop off
- You want performance reporting across channels
- You can track key actions as events such as form submit, book call, purchase
2. Behavior Analytics
This layer answers: why visitors are not converting.
Microsoft Clarity
Best for: heatmaps and session recordings with simple setup.
Use it when:
- You want fast insight into friction and confusion
- You want to prioritize conversion improvements based on real sessions
Hotjar
Best for: session replay plus behavior insights and quick feedback signals.
Use it when:
- You want strong UX insight on landing pages and forms
- You want to find drop offs and confusion on high intent pages
FullStory
Best for: deeper session replay workflows and analysis at scale.
Use it when:
- You need faster ways to locate the sessions that matter
- You want more advanced investigation features for conversion issues
3. Lead Generation Tracking
This layer answers: who is showing intent, and how do we follow up.
HubSpot Tracking Code
Best for: teams using HubSpot for lead capture and lifecycle tracking.
Use it when:
- You want marketing and CRM to share one view of the journey
- You want website activity connected to lead records and reporting
VisitorStack
Best for: anonymous website visitor identification that is designed to turn existing traffic into measurable follow up and ROI.
Use it when:
- You care about improving lead flow from the traffic you already have
- You want identification plus practical activation, such as building intent based audiences and re engaging visitors who did not convert
- You want a trusted provider focused on outcomes, not just dashboards
4. Product Analytics for Funnel Optimization
This layer answers: which behaviors predict conversion, and how cohorts move through your funnel.
Heap
Best for: automatic capture of interactions and flexible analysis without heavy manual event setup.
Use it when:
- You want to reduce dependency on engineering for event tracking
- You want fast funnel insight across many interactions
How to Choose the Right Stack in 5 Minutes
Use this quick decision flow.
- Do you need conversion and funnel reporting
Start with GA4. - Do you need to see why visitors do not convert
Add Clarity or Hotjar. - Do you sell to businesses and want visibility into high intent visitors
Add a lead generation layer like VisitorStack, depending on your workflow and the type of identification and activation you want. - Are you managing leads inside HubSpot
Use the HubSpot tracking code to connect site activity to your CRM. - Do you want deeper product style analytics and auto capture
Consider Heap.
What to Look For in Any Tool
If your goal is lead generation, prioritize these capabilities.
- Intent tracking on high intent pages
Pricing, services, demo, case studies, comparison pages - Clear visitor journeys
Page sequence, repeat visits, key clicks, and drop off points - Conversion visibility
Form starts, submits, and funnel drop off - Audience activation
Ability to build remarketing segments based on behavior and intent - Workflow fit
Integrations into your CRM and marketing stack where your team already operates
The Fastest Lead Generation Setup
If you want the quickest path to measurable lift, start here.
- Install GA4 and track key events for your primary lead action
- Install a replay tool like Clarity or Hotjar and review your top three lead pages
- Build one intent segment: visitors who viewed pricing or services but did not convert
- Improve one high impact page per week based on replay patterns
- Review weekly: conversion rate, lead volume, and which pages create the most intent
By WAI Editorial Team
